    Exploring the Cataloochee Valley and Its Elk Population

    If you're a nature lover or history buff, exploring the Cataloochee Valley is a must. This historic valley, located within the Great Smoky Mountains National Park, offers a unique blend of natural beauty and historical significance. The valley is home to well-preserved historic buildings, providing a glimpse into the region's past. You can wander through the old schoolhouse, the church, and other structures, learning about the lives of the early settlers. The valley is also renowned for its elk population. In the early 2000s, elk were reintroduced to the area, and they have thrived. It's a fantastic opportunity to observe these majestic animals in their natural habitat. The best time to see the elk is typically during the early morning or late evening hours. Remember to bring binoculars and a camera to capture these incredible creatures. Be sure to maintain a safe distance from the elk, as they are wild animals and can be unpredictable. When exploring the valley, follow park guidelines to protect the environment and wildlife.
